problem with minimum weight is that most folks can't judge a deers weight when it is a lone deer 150 yards away in a late evening greenfield.
When I hunted Greene Co I killed 20-35 does a year on two clubs. By adhering to lone doe/first deer rules I cannot recall ever killing a button buck in that time except for ONE.
